Study summary
The efficacy of long-term treatment with different GLP-1RA (Duragtide, Semaglutide, losenatide, tirzepatide, ebenatide, etc.) was evaluated through 1-4 years of follow-up, and the effects of long-term treatment on blood glucose and body fat of patients.
At present, there has been no evaluation on the efficacy of long-term treatment of different GLP-1RA (Duragtide, Semaglutide, losenatide, tirzepatide, ebenatide, etc.), and the effects of long-term treatment on patients' blood glucose and body fat. This study intends to follow up for 1-4 years. To observe the effects of different GLP-1RA on body fat, insulin resistance, body weight, blood glucose, blood lipids, stomach volume, etc., in patients with type 2 diabetes, and explore the factors affecting the efficacy, so as to provide more evidence-based medical evidence for drug treatment and benefit patients.

Eligibility
Inclusion Criteria: 1. Diagnosed type 2 diabetes according to the 1999 WHO standards; 2. received at least 8 weeks of simple diet control and physical exercise before screening; Patients with type 2 diabetes who were treated with stable hypoglycemic drugs and had inadequate glycemic control within 8 weeks prior to screening; 3. HbA1c≥7.5%; 4. BMI\>24kg/m2; 5. Subjects agree to maintain a scientific diet and exercise habits throughout the study, and regularly self-monitor and record blood sugar (SMBG); 6. Be willing to sign written informed consent and comply with the study protocol Exclusion Criteria: 1. Use of any of the following drugs or treatments in the 3 months prior to screening: treatment with GLP-1RA, GLP-1 analogue, DPP-4 inhibitor, or any other incretin analogue; 2. Long-term (more than 7 consecutive days) intravenous administration, oral administration, or intra-articular administration of corticosteroids within 2 months prior to screening; 3. Use of weight control drugs or surgery that can lead to weight instability within 2 months before screening, or are currently in a weight loss program and not in the maintenance stage: 4. History of acute and chronic pancreatitis; A history of medullary C-cell carcinoma, MEN (multiple endocrine tumors) 2A or 2B syndrome, or related family history; 5. Clinically significant gastric emptying abnormalities; 6. tumors of any organ system that have been treated or not treated in the 5 years prior to screening; 7. had received coronary angioplasty, coronary stenting, or coronary artery bypass within 6 months before screening. Negligent compensatory heart failure (NYHA rating III and IV), stroke or transient ischemic attack, unstable angina, myocardial infarction, persistent and clinically significant arrhythmia; 8. Acute metabolic complications occurred within 6 months before screening; 9. Before screening, any of the laboratory test indicators meet the following criteria: glutamic-pyrugenic transaminase \>2.5 times or ASpartate transaminase \>2.5 times; eGFR \<45ml/min/1.73m2; Fasting glycerin tricol \>5.64mmol/L.
